Jalen Johnson is an American professional basketball player who plays for the Atlanta Hawks. Now in his third NBA season, Johnson has established himself as a starter on the Hawks team, and averaged an impressive 16.0 points per game in the 2023/24 season.

Johnson was in contention for the Most Improved Player (MIP) award, but due to injuries he didn't meet the 65 games criteria. He started 52 games out of 56, and averaged 16.0 points, 8.7 rebounds and 3.6 assists. He adds versatility to the Hawks lineup, can guard multiple positions, and play both as a small or power forward.

The 22-year-old has become an integral part of the Hawks franchise, becoming a two-way player. He is seen as the third option behind Trae Young and Dejounte Murray.

Jalen Johnson Draft

Jalen Johnson was drafted by the Atlanta Hawks with the 20th overall pick in the 2021 NBA Draft. He had a successful high-school career, and was rated as a five-star recruit in college.

Johnson only played 13 games for the Duke Blue Devils in college, before leaving in the middle of the season to prepare for the draft. He averaged 11.2 points, 6.1 rebounds and 2.2 assists with 1.2 steals and 1.2 blocks. He then declared for the 2021 NBA Draft, and despite a smaller sample size, the Hawks saw the potential and drafted him.

Jalen Johnson Position

Johnson plays as a small-forward for the Hawks, but has the versatility to play as a power forward as well. At 6 feet 9 inches tall, with a 6 foot 11 inch wingspan, Johnson’s strength is his versatile offensive game. He likes to drive to the basket and is great at finishing strongly in the paint. He also has a 3-point shot and takes more than 3.5 3-pointers per game. His big wingspan helps him contest shots at the rim and as well as helps him in getting steals.
